I work in a printing shop, and the issue you’re having with the color is likely due to the color profile. I recommend working in CMYK; the colors you see on the screen will be closer to what you print. If you send a file in RGB, the printer’s software will handle the conversion, and it might not look the same. Also, keep in mind that it will always appear darker and less saturated than on the screen.

I had a case like that at one point except it was a mid tower, not a mini. 4x 5.25" & 2x 3.5" bays, iirc. I always assumed the inverted layout was just to make the optical drives etc more accessible when it was sitting on top of a desk instead of under it. I think what made these cases go away was the ATX standard since that specified a lot more things regarding the layout of various things on the motherboard, etc which would have made this style of case impossible to conform to.

That processor socket isn't for a math coprocessor. It is for upgrading the board to a different CPU like a faster 486 or a Pentium Overdrive. The 486 already has a math co processor built in the CPU. Also, did you know that there are epoxies for plastic now? They bond to plastic better than standard epoxy.
